- Name Counter overflow ?The SAP error message CFD_ARCHIVE001: Name Counter overflow typically occurs in the context of archiving documents in the SAP system. This error indicates that the system has reached the maximum limit for the name counter used for generating unique names for archived documents.
Cause:
- Name Counter Limit: Each archived document is assigned a unique name based on a counter. If the system has archived a large number of documents, it can exhaust the available range of unique names.
- Configuration Issues: Incorrect configuration settings related to archiving or document management can also lead to this error.
Solution:
To resolve the CFD_ARCHIVE001 error, you can take the following steps:
Reset the Name Counter:
- You may need to reset the name counter for the archiving object. This can typically be done through transaction codes like SARA (Archive Administration) or SARI (Archive Information System).
- Check the specific archiving object settings and see if there is an option to reset or reinitialize the counter.
Check Archiving Configuration:
- Review the configuration settings for the archiving object in question. Ensure that the settings are correct and that the system is configured to handle the expected volume of archived documents.
Increase the Counter Limit:
- If possible, consider increasing the limit for the name counter. This may involve adjustments in the database or configuration settings.
Delete Old Archives:
- If the system is not actively using older archived documents, consider deleting or moving them to free up the name counter.
Consult SAP Notes:
-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ates that can help resolve the issue.
